Delivery: ex stock/3 weeks | Warranty: 24 months Metal Bellows Coupling MODEL 8690 Highlights R ated torques from 0 ... ±0,5 N·m to 0 ... ± 200 N·m A daptation to the required shaft diameter A ccurate transmission of angle and torque S uitable for dynamic and static application Options Keyways F inely balanced version Applications S imple assembly and safe integration of torque sensors C ompensation of shaft diameter Product description Even after careful alignment of the shaft ends of the sensors with the shaft ends of the plant; slight axial, angular or lateral shift must be anticipated. These interfere with the measurement and can lead to damage on the sensor in the event of high speeds. Rated torque ≥ 2 N·m The 8690-type steel bellow coupling is fastened, using a clamping hub per torque transmission, to the sensor and plant shafts. The facility-side bore is adapted to the existing shaft diameter, which means that the torque sensor can be mechanically integrated without further adaptations. A stainless steel bellow transmits the torque between the clamping hubs without backlash. Through its highly elastic but stiff material properties, a lossless transfer of the torque transmission is guaranteed. Open the catalog to page 2Dimensional drawing Model 8690 For detailed dimensions, you can find the CAD data of the sensor on our website www.burster.de Mounting The couplings have two different attachment systems: To rated torque 0.5 N·m: The coupling has two radial set screws (ISO 4029). The screws are forming an angle of 120°. The screws are arranged at an angle of 120° to each other and press directly on the shaft. With integrated disassembly nut. Mounting instructions From rated torque 1 N·m: The connection between the shaft and coupling is made with a clamping hub. Only one radially arranged clamping screw (ISO 4762)...
